Discharge screen printing is when you use a water based ink with a special discharge agent mixed in to print your custom designs onto garments.  Most standard screen printing is done with plastisol inks which are great for keeping costs low since you can reuse them and they won’t dry up when exposed to air, but there are some drawbacks.  One drawback is that plastisol inks dry stiff and for some, that can be an undesirable ‘hand’ to the print.  Water based inks leave behind a much softer hand, but they are susceptible to drying out so you need to mix just the amount you need and move quickly!  Discharge printing is really just a water based ink that has a discharge agent in it which can remove the garment’s existing color so that you can deposit the desired one in its place.

In discharge printing you will get the softest hand possible because the ink penetrates deeply and doesn’t leave a firm coat on the surface of the garment.  After one or two washes it will feel like the print has always been a part of the garment!  If you are in need of quality contract discharge printers and you want to get started right away, you needn’t look any further than to us here at AMBRO Manufacturing.  You can easily contact us to place an order or to find out more, by email or by giving us a call at (908) 806-8337.

Leather embossing is not as hard as you may think it is, but you need a couple of things before jumping into the leather embossing process. First you will need the leather that you want to be embossed as well as a die, which is a stamp of the logo or design you want to have on your book. Next, you will need a leather embossing machine, which we have our very own right here in our warehouse. Leather embossing will leave a raised imprint of your design, rather than a sunken in imprint. The leather embossing stamp is basically just an outline of your logo, and when pressed onto the piece of leather it will force the leather to rise up. Leather embossing has a very elegant, sophisticated element to it that you don’t find very often.
